Quarterly Planning Note — Hiring Freeze, Consumer Division

Heads of department: as flagged last month, Consumer is on a hiring freeze through the next two quarters. Backfills need VP sign-off; everything else waits. Other divisions are unaffected, so please don't let the rumour mill say otherwise. Contractor extensions are fine within existing budgets. We'll revisit at the mid-year review. The confidential note below covers the restructuring plans behind this.

board note of tawig-bajof: The renewal with Ralixix Holdings closes at $10 million a year, 20 percent above the last contract. Project Druix slips by two quarters because of the tooling delay.

Attendees: R. Okafor (chair), L. Dunmore, P. Szabo, H. Ferrell.

The launch of the Clearbrook analytics suite is confirmed for early next quarter. Marketing spend was approved at the revised level, with a contingency of 8% held by finance. Dunmore will finalise channel pricing by Friday. Support staffing will be reviewed once pre-orders open. Szabo flagged a supplier delay on packaging; mitigation agreed. Finance should note the strategic context recorded below before modelling projections.

management briefing: Project Ulavan slips by two quarters because of the staffing delay.

Releases ship monthly; the release manager should confirm that downstream blueprint packages pass the compatibility suite before tagging. Breaking changes to default generators require a minor-version bump and a changelog entry. Known issues and deprecation timelines are tracked in the project board, and the upgrade guide covers every supported migration path. If a release is blocked or a compatibility failure can't be triaged from the docs, contact the maintainers at the address below.

escalation mailbox, yajeg-bageg: quenax.olidor@lumiccorp.internal

Fan-out backpressure for the Quillet notifier: when the queue depth crosses the soft limit, the dispatcher sheds low-priority pushes and batches the rest at 500ms intervals. Reviewer should confirm the shed counter is exported and that retries respect the jitter window. Once merged, the release artifact gets re-signed by the pipeline, which expects the deploy key shown below.

deploy key for bawep-yawif: bky6_GQhaSt